Survival outcomes in non-small cell lung cancer: Real-world analysis of immunotherapy era vs pre-immunotherapy era, with insights into treatment settings, racial disparities, and socioeconomic impacts.
Abstract
e20597 Background: Immunotherapy has transformed non-small cell lung cancer (NSCLC) outcomes, with pivotal trials like IMpower010, PACIFIC, and KEYNOTE 189 showcasing its efficacy. Using data from the National Cancer Data Base, this study evaluates survival trends in the immunotherapy era (IE) versus the pre-immunotherapy era (PIE) focusing on geographic, socioeconomic, and racial disparities. Methods: Survival probabilities were analyzed with Kaplan-Meier plots, and log-rank tests compared outcomes between IE (2016–2021) and PIE (2010–2015). Median OS, 5-year OS, and Cox regression hazard ratios (HR) assessed demographic, clinical, and socioeconomic impacts on NSCLC survival (p < 0.05). Results: Data from 1,516,865 NSCLC patients showed significant survival improvements across all stages in the immunotherapy era (p < 0.001). Survival was higher for patients treated at academic centers (p < 0.001). However, racial disparities persisted, with Asian and Hispanic patients having better outcomes than non-Hispanic Black and White patients. Cox regression revealed immunotherapy reduced mortality (HR = 0.59, p < 0.001). Advanced stages, particularly Stage IV (HR = 7.06, p < 0.001), were linked to higher mortality. Protective factors included female sex (HR = 0.75), younger age, and academic center care (HR = 0.84; p < 0.001). Uninsured (HR = 1.33) and Medicaid patients (HR = 1.55) had worse outcomes, higher income and education levels improved survival. The table below presents the median survival for all the variables. Conclusions: Immunotherapy has significantly improved NSCLC survival at all stages. Better outcomes were seen with academic center care, private insurance, and higher socioeconomic status, highlighting the need for equitable access. Racial disparities persist, requiring targeted interventions, and advanced-stage patients continue to face poor outcomes, stressing the need for early detection. These findings emphasize reducing socioeconomic and racial disparities and expanding therapy access to improve survival for all NSCLC patients.
